Weather in August

August, the last month of the summer in Redland, is another hot month, with an average temperature ranging between min 71.2°F (21.8°C) and max 93.2°F (34°C).

Temperature

As July transitions into August, the average high-temperature rests at a still tropical 93.2°F (34°C), maintaining a close resemblance to the previous month. From the heights of the August heat, Redland records a mean nighttime low of 71.2°F (21.8°C).

Heat index

The average heat index in August is evaluated at a blazing hot 116.6°F (47°C). Vigilance: Heat cramps and heat exhaustion are likely. The likelihood of heatstroke increases with continued activity.
Keep in mind the heat index values are meant for areas in shade and with light wind. Exposure to direct sunlight may make the heat index values climb by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'feels like', embodies the combination of air temperature and moisture content to illustrate perceived heat. This impact is subjective, influenced by the person's physical activity and individual heat perception, affected by factors including wind, attire, and metabolic differences. Bear in mind that direct sunshine exposure increases weather impact, and may raise heat index by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are of high significance for children. Children often lack awareness of the importance of taking breaks and rehydrating. The feeling of thirst is a late indication of dehydration, so maintaining hydration, especially during long periods of physical activity, is critical.
The human body normally cools itself by perspiration, as evaporated sweat carries heat away from the body. When relative humidity is heightened, it slows the rate of evaporation, thereby decreasing the body's ability to shed heat and creating a sensation of overheating. If the body retains more heat than it can expel, the increasing temperature can lead to heat-related conditions.

UV index

In Redland, the average daily maximum UV index in August is 6.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health vulnerability from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for the average person.
Note: The maximum UV index of 6 during August translates into these guidelines:
Use measures and accept sun safety conventions. Guarding against skin and eye trauma is of high priority. Minimize exposure to direct sunlight and seek shade from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m., when UV radiation is most intense, but remember that shade structures may not offer complete protection. For minimizing sun-related eye damage, always choose sunglasses with UVA and UVB coverage.
